How to Choose the Best PCIe Capture Card for Your Board

Before comparing capture specifications, work out what your motherboard can actually give the card. These four checks catch the problems that appear after installation rather than before it. Getting the best PCIe capture card right starts with the block diagram.

Lane allocation and shared bandwidth

Capture cards typically use a x4 connector, and they will run in any physically longer slot. The problem is that many boards give a secondary slot only one lane, or disable it entirely when a second M.2 drive is installed in the shared socket. Slot count tells you almost nothing on its own.

The block diagram in your motherboard manual shows exactly which devices compete. Reading it before you buy takes five minutes and avoids the common outcome of a capture card working while a storage drive silently drops to a slower mode. Five minutes of reading avoids a bad surprise.

Slot placement, length and airflow

Modern graphics cards are thick enough to cover the slot immediately below them, and several are long enough to overlap a second slot entirely. Measure the space rather than assuming the slot is usable simply because it exists on the board. Card length is as important as slot position.

Capture cards also generate heat and usually rely on case airflow rather than an active fan. Mounting one directly beneath a graphics card that exhausts downward is the most common cause of a card running hotter than it should. Passive cards depend entirely on case airflow.

Capture format and what your system must handle

Consumer cards output compressed video, which keeps processor load and file sizes reasonable. Professional cards deliver uncompressed frames, which preserves quality for editing but requires far more from both the processor and the storage subsystem. Storage requirements follow from this choice.

Match this to your actual workflow. Streaming and gameplay recording work perfectly with compressed output, while uncompressed capture only makes sense when the footage will be graded or when a broadcast pipeline demands it. Most people need compressed output only.

Driver quality and software support

There is no class-compliant standard for PCIe capture, so every card depends on a driver and on the manufacturer maintaining it. That makes long-term support a real consideration rather than a detail you can safely ignore at purchase time. Support length varies enormously by brand.

Confirm the card appears natively in OBS Studio rather than only through a proprietary application. A card that requires an extra software layer adds another component that can break after an update, in a workflow you need to be dependable. An extra software layer is another failure point.

Elgato 4K Pro

For a gaming build this is the card to beat, capturing 4K60 with HDR10 and passing through up to 4K144 with variable refresh rate preserved. Driver support has been consistent and it appears directly as a source inside OBS Studio. Driver updates have been steady on this one.

It is long enough that slot clearance needs checking in a case already holding a large graphics card. It is also the most expensive gaming option here, and 4K60 recordings fill a drive faster than most people expect. Long cards and crowded cases rarely mix well.

AVerMedia Live Gamer 4K 2.1

The closest competitor matches 4K60 capture and 4K144 passthrough for less money, which makes it the value choice at the top of the market. It installs the same way and presents itself to streaming software without any complication. It is the value option at flagship level.

The bundled application is weaker than Elgato’s, so plan on using OBS. Reports of fussy behaviour with specific monitors in certain passthrough modes make it worth confirming compatibility with your display before buying. Check your display before committing to it.

Magewell Pro Capture HDMI 4K Plus

Magewell is the professional option, delivering uncompressed capture at up to 4K30 with drivers maintained across operating systems for years rather than months. In production environments that longevity is the reason people pay the premium. Slot consolidation is the real advantage.

There is no passthrough, no HDR support and no gaming focus at all. Uncompressed output also places real demands on storage and processor, so it is a poor fit for anyone simply wanting to record gameplay sessions. One input is enough for most streamers.

AVerMedia Live Gamer Duo

Two HDMI inputs on one card means a console and a camera, or two machines, can be captured without a second slot. On a board where slots are scarce, that consolidation is worth more than the specification alone suggests. Uncompressed output needs a dedicated drive.

Both inputs cap at 1080p60, so 4K recording is not an option. Anyone capturing a single source will get better capability for the same money from a standard one-input card, making this a workflow-specific purchase. It is built for production, not for gaming.

Elgato 4K60 Pro MK.2

The older generation still captures 4K60 with HDR10 and passes the same resolution through, and it now sells for noticeably less. Paired with a 60Hz display it produces effectively the same result as the current model. It suits a 60Hz display without complaint.

Passthrough has no high refresh or variable refresh support, which rules it out for a 120Hz or 144Hz monitor. Availability is also inconsistent, since retailers are clearing remaining stock rather than reordering it. Availability is inconsistent at this point.

Frequently Asked Questions

Common questions from readers installing a capture card in a desktop, covering slots, lanes, heat and operating system support. They come up most from readers fitting the best PCIe capture card into an existing build.

Can I put a x4 card in a x16 slot?

Yes, and it will work normally. The card only uses the lanes it needs, so the main consideration is whether the slot itself receives enough lanes from the chipset once your other devices are installed. Lane count is the number that matters.

Will it conflict with my M.2 drives?

It can on compact boards, where a secondary slot shares bandwidth with an M.2 socket. Check the block diagram in the manual, since the conflict usually appears as reduced drive speed rather than as an obvious failure. Reduced drive speed is the usual symptom.

Do capture cards need extra cooling?

Most rely on case airflow and have no fan of their own. Avoid mounting one directly under a graphics card that exhausts downward, and leave a slot gap if the layout of your board and case allows it. A slot gap helps more than people expect.

Do these work on Linux?

Support varies considerably by manufacturer, and consumer gaming cards are generally the weakest in this respect. Professional cards from broadcast-focused brands usually provide better documented drivers for non-Windows systems. Check documentation before assuming support.
